Page 33 text:

THE TATTLETALE 27 ROBERT BALCOLM FISHER • ' Bob Bob ' has been voted our best boy athlete and well he deserves the honor. Ask him what 7-12 means? He knows. I like work; it fascinates nye. I can sit and look at it for hours. I love to keep it by me; the idea of getting rid of it nearly breaks my heart. Dance Committee ' 25- ' 26 (Chairman); Letter Club ' 26- , 27- , 28; Hi-Y Club ' 27-28; Glee Club ' 27; Football ' 26- ' 27; Basketball ' 26- ' 27- ' 28 (Captain); Track ' 26- ' 2 7- ' 28 ; Class Team ' 25 ; Class Prophet ' 28. GLADYS CATHERINE FOREMAN Commercial Bryant and Stratton Gladiola Gladiola is another popular girl with the members of the class. We are sure that she will succeed as an ac- countant. Let us then be up and doing, With a heart for any fate; Still achieving, still pursuing, Learn to labor and to wait. Glee Club ' 2 7- ' 28. AUGUST VICTOR FRIENSEHNER Technical Northeastern University Vic Vic has been rather active while in the A. H. S. If you have any electrical troubles, ask Vic about them. He wishes to be an administrative engineer. He wears the rose of youth upon him. Assistant Business Manager Blue Owl ' 28; Ex-Lib- ris Club ' 26- ' 27; French Club ' 26- ' 27; German Club ' 26- ' 2 7; Science Club ' 26- 27.

Page 32 text:

26 THE T A T T L E TALE NORMAN FRANCIS ELSBREE Commercial Boston University Norm. ' Norm. ' is, of course, our best boy musician. He has played for several of our socials. He is going to be an accountant. He touched his sax., and nations heard entranced As some vast river of unfailing source. Rapid, exhaustless, deep, his numbers flowed And opened new fountains in the human heart. Assistant Business Manager of Tattletale ; Strum- mers ' 27; Orchestra ' lb- 21 -lb; Band ' 28; Track ' 21. Co mmercial FRANCIS J. FERRARA Columbia University We all know Frank by the luscious smile on his face and the notebook in his hand. As a reporter, we know that Frank will never fail to get plenty of news. Good actions crown themselves with lasting lays; Who well deserves needs not another ' s praises. Dance Committee ' 24- ' 25; Radio Club; Football ' 24; Basketball ' 24- ' 25; Track ' 25- ' 26- ' 27- ' 28; Class Teams ' 25; School Reporter for Sun ' 26- ' 27- ' 28. Page 34 text:

28 THE TAT T L E T A L E ommercia JULIAN SANDERSON FROST Jute ' Jute has been a shining light in the Class of 1928 s athletic history. We wish him the same success in busi- ness administration. Why should he study and make himself mad? Dance Committee ' 2 5; Letter Club ' 2 7; Hi-Y Club •27- ' 28; Football ' 25- ' 26- ' 27; Basketball ' 26- , 27- ' 28; Track 26- ' 27- ' 28; Class Baseball ' 28; Class Teams ' 25- ' 26- ' 2 7; Manager of Track ' 2 7. BEATRICE MIRIAM FULLER Commercial Ned Wayburn ' s School of Dancing Bea All of us know Bea as a dancer; many of us know her as a real friend. But oh! she dances such a way! No sun upon an Easter day Is half so fine a sight. School Play Candy Committee ' 28; Senior Class Pin Committee (Chairman) ; Junior Tax Committee; Junior Decorating Committee; Dance Committee ' 2 5- ' 26 ' 2 7; German Club ' 2 7. Coi HAZEL ELIZABETH CARD New England Conservatory of Music Hazel has given us the opportunity of hearing her play the piano more than once. What a fine music teach- er she will make! My lady would also, at times when she was not too bored, play Beethoven s and Wagner ' s river music not ill. German Club ' 2 7; Gregg Speedsters.
